Thornbury Primary School

"Roaring into the Arts"


Thornbury is a small school (population 145) with a very mixed group of students. 61% of our families come from low socio economic backgrounds where assistance is provided via the Education Maintenance Allowance (EMA). 40% of our population are indigenous.

Our proposal is for the whole school to attend a matinee performance of the "The Lion King" that is opening at The Regent Theatre on July 28th. Students from our school have limited opportunities to attend live theatre events such as 'The Lion King' due to the prohibitive costs involved for our families. Anecdotally only two students have been to a large theatrical experience.

The opportunity to attend live theatre on such a grand scale, would I'm sure, inspire our students in a variety of ways. There would be the opportunity for follow up work in literacy, music, drama and the visual arts. Also our unique Indigenous Studies classes could link the theme of African and Australian culture.

How will the funds be used?


Theatre tickets: $59.75ea X 145 students = $8663.75
Buses: $220 ea X 4 buses = $880
Sub TOTAL $9543.75
Student Contribution: $10 ea X 145 students = less $1450
TOTAL funds needed $8093.75
